Editorial Notes

A compelling phlebotomist cover letter effectively showcases precision, patient safety, and efficiency. Healthcare hiring managers specifically look for quantifiable achievements, such as venipuncture success rates, high daily draw volumes, and an impeccable record of adhering to patient identification protocols. Demonstrating proficiency with diverse patient populations, including challenging pediatric draws, alongside meticulous specimen handling and EMR system expertise, signals a highly competent candidate. The ability to reassure patients and maintain composure in fast-paced environments is also crucial.

This example letter excels by immediately presenting a powerful, quantified hook: a 98% first-attempt success rate across 55 daily venipunctures. It then elaborates on core phlebotomy duties, detailing strict adherence to the 3-point patient identification protocol across over 1,500 draws, successful challenging pediatric capillary draws, and efficient specimen processing. The applicant thoughtfully connects their strengths, like precision and patient safety, to Cumberland Health Partners' specific focus on advanced diagnostics and community-focused care. A confident closing statement then invites further discussion.

Frequently Asked Questions

What should an entry-level Phlebotomist highlight in their cover letter?
Emphasize precision in venipuncture and capillary draws, showcasing specific techniques and patient identification protocols. Quantify achievements like first-attempt success rates, daily draw volumes, or experience with diverse patient demographics (pediatric, geriatric), and mention any relevant certifications or clinical rotations. Focus on the impact of accuracy and patient safety.
What is the ideal length for a Phlebotomist cover letter?
Keep the cover letter concise, ideally a single page comprising three to four substantial paragraphs. Recruiters often scan these documents quickly, so ensure every sentence is impactful and directly relevant to the phlebotomist role. Prioritize quality and specificity over excessive length, avoiding generic statements.
How should a Phlebotomist open their cover letter to grab attention?
Start immediately with a strong, quantifiable achievement or a compelling claim that highlights your value as a Phlebotomist. Instead of generic phrases, open with a specific success such as a high first-attempt draw rate, efficiency in high-volume settings, or specialized experience with challenging draws, providing brief context for the accomplishment.
How can a candidate address having no direct experience as a Phlebotomist?
If truly entry-level, focus on your phlebotomy certification, successful completion of clinical rotations, and any relevant transferable skills from customer service or other healthcare support roles. Highlight practical training in venipuncture, specimen handling, infection control, and patient communication, emphasizing your commitment to learning and adherence to strict protocols.
How should a Phlebotomist's cover letter differ from their resume?
The cover letter expands on 2-3 key accomplishments from your resume, providing more detailed context, specific methods used, and the direct impact of your actions. It also allows you to articulate your genuine interest in the specific company and role, explaining how your skills and career goals align with their mission or values in a more personal, narrative tone.
